The 22127 / 28 Anandwan Express is a Superfast Express train belonging to Indian Railways Central Zone that runs between Lokmanya Tilak Terminus and Kazipet Junction in India.

It operates as train number 22127 from Lokmanya Tilak Terminus to Kazipet Junction and as train number 22128 in the reverse direction, serving the states of Maharashtra and Telangana.[2]


Coaches


The 22127 / 28 Anandwan Express has 1 AC 2-tier, 4 AC 3-tier, 12 sleeper class, 3 general unreserved & two SLR (seating with luggage rake) coaches . It does not carry a pantry car.

As is customary with most train services in India, coach composition may be amended at the discretion of Indian Railways depending on demand.


Service


The 22127 Lokmanya Tilak Terminus–Kazipet Junction Anandwan Express covers the distance of 1,105 km (687 mi) in 19 hours 15 mins (57 km/hr) & in 19 hours 15 mins as the 22128 Kazipet Junction–Lokmanya Tilak Terminus Anandwan Express (57 km/hr).

As the average speed of the train is more than 55 km/h (34 mph), as per railway rules, its fare includes a Superfast surcharge.

Routing


The 22127 / 28 Anandwan Express runs from Lokmanya Tilak Terminus via Kalyan Junction, Bhusaval Junction, Akola Junction, Badnera Junction, Wardha Junction, Chandrapur, Balharshah Junction, Ramagundam to Kazipet Junction.[3]


Traction


As the route is electrified, a Bhusaval-based WAP-4 or Ajni-based WAP-7 pulls the train to its destination.
